The title refers to the penultimate episode of the second season, titled "The Battle for Social Rehabilitation." This specific episode is widely regarded as a masterclass in modern animation and character-driven storytelling.

Produced by and directed by Yuzuru Tachikawa, Episode 12 is often cited for its "sakuga"—a term used to describe exceptionally high-quality animation.
